The Levin range centres on hybrid powertrains, pairing a fuel-efficient petrol engine with electric motor assistance. This hybrid setup delivers strong fuel economy—a key advantage in Ghana's market, where running costs matter as much as purchase price. Most buyers opt for mid-range trims that balance equipment and cost, though higher trims add comfort features like climate control, infotainment upgrades, and enhanced interior trim. Engine displacement typically sits between 1.5 and 1.8 litres, with the hybrid system managing power delivery across urban and highway driving.
The Levin sits firmly in the compact sedan class—roughly 4.6 metres long with a wheelbase around 2.7 metres. This makes it easy to manoeuvre through Ghanaian city streets and park in tight spaces, while the rear bench and boot offer genuine family practicality. Fuel tank capacity is typically in the 50-litre range, giving realistic range on a single fill.
Ghana's tropical climate and coastal humidity mean buyers should prioritise models with robust air conditioning and corrosion-resistant undercoating. The Levin's Japanese build quality handles humid conditions well.
